Nokia Lumina 800 (WP7) Finally Arrives at Telstra
Finally the long awaiting Nokia Lumina is available in Australia through Telstra shops and also online. Other Australian carriers have made the Lumina 800 available in previous weeks, but today sees Australia’s largest carrier (Telstra) coming on board with the phone.
